Lectio: Mk 6.34-44

Meditatio: “When he [Jesus] disembarked and saw the vast crowd, his heart was moved to pity for them, for they were like sheep without a shepherd, and he began to teach them many things.” Mk 6.334

Oratio: "O God, You made us in Your image but Your emotions are so much more powerful than ours.

I remember Jesus was moved to pity by a vast crowd and He first taught them to feed their spiritual needs and then fed them with five loaves and two fish to satisfy their physical needs - How awesome and how wonderful!

Grant that I may imitate Your Son and allow the energy of my emotions to prompt me to reach out to others in their needs.

I ask this of You, who lives and reigns with Jesus and the Holy Spirit, one God, forever.
Amen.”

Contemplatio: Keep silence and remain in recollection for a few minutes.

Operatio: Reflect on my emotional package. See how they are powerful energy sources which can be used for good or cause evil. Resolve to use the energies of my emotions for the good of others and my own good.
